Title:
HOME LITERACY ENVIRONMENTS AND THE READING LEVELS OF GRADE 2 LEARNERS: FOUNDATION FOR ENHANCED HOME READING PROGRAM

Authors:
Mildred Lerios Dumlao, Philippines

Abstract:
The purpose of this study was to determine the home literacy environment and the reading levels of Grade 2 learners, as perceived by reading facilitators in Palauig District, Schools Division of Zambales, during the School Year 2023-2024. A quantitative-descriptive research approach was utilized for this study. Data collection was conducted through a validated questionnaire. The questionnaire focused on various aspects of the home literacy environment, including reading materials, access to community resources, engagement in reading activities, and involvement in reading. Additionally, Filipino and English reading levels of learners were evaluated using CRLA-based reading levels. The results indicated that both learners and reading facilitators recognized the importance of HLEs, particularly in terms of reading materials, access to community resources, engagement in reading activities, and involvement in reading. However, the Filipino and English reading results of learners revealed a light refresher reading level, as per the CRLA-based assessment. Furthermore, there was no significant difference observed in the perception of HLEs between learners and reading facilitators across all dimensions. Additionally, there was a very low and non-significant correlation found between learners' HLEs and their CRLA-based reading levels, which persisted across various dimensions. The study concluded that there is a need for an enhanced program targeting specific areas identified for improvement in the HLEs and the reading levels of Grade 2 learners. Despite the recognition of the importance of HLEs by both learners and reading facilitators, the study highlighted the need for interventions to address the observed light refresher reading levels and the lack of significant correlation between HLEs and reading levels.
